Futuristic Museum Debuts Intelligent, AI-Boosted Humanoid Robot Named 'Ameca'

In an exciting development, the advanced humanoid robot, Ameca, is now located on the "Tomorrow, Today" floor at the Museum of the Future. This renowned institution, known for its cutting-edge exhibits, is hosting an exclusive event - the AI Retreat - alongside Ameca's upgraded version launch.

Ameca, developed by Engineered Arts, is a world-leading humanoid robot, renowned for its realistic facial expressions, natural responses, and precise movements. The robot, which can speak multiple languages, including Japanese, German, Chinese, French, and English (with both British and American accents), serves as a multilingual guide for the museum's diverse global audience. It also functions as an intelligent assistant for museum visitors, offering a unique blend of human-like interaction and artificial intelligence.

The AI Retreat, an invitation-only gathering, is a significant event for discussing AI's impact on various sectors, including the economy, data, infrastructure, and talent development. Over 100 global leaders, tech innovators, and decision-makers are attending this event, which aims to redefine boundaries between humans and machines.

Ameca is powered by the Tritium 3 system and is capable of integrating with advanced AI tools such as facial and voice recognition, instant translation, and emotion analysis. Although its advanced capabilities at the Museum of the Future are yet to be fully revealed, it is expected that Ameca's locomotion capabilities will be enhanced by early 2026.
